Subject: Seed samples for the Bramleigh trial plot

Hi dispatch crew,

Quick one — the Verdona seed samples for the Bramleigh trial plot are boxed and sitting on rack C. Tomas from agronomy needs them at the plot gate by Thursday morning, otherwise we miss the sowing window and he'll never let us hear the end of it. They're light but fragile, so keep them off the bottom of the van. The courier run is already booked with Quickfern. The hand-over instruction for the courier is below.

dispatch memo: the quenax olidor courier leaves the lamvan aldath keliel ledger at gate 2085 under passcode 005795

The renewal of our three-year agreement with Torvane Materials has been assessed in detail. Proposed terms include a 4.2% unit-price increase, partially offset by improved volume rebates and extended payment terms of sixty days. Sensitivity analysis indicates a net annual cost impact of under 1% on the Meridia product line, assuming stable demand. Legal has flagged no material changes to liability clauses. We recommend approval, subject to the conditions outlined in the confidential note below.

confidential, yawip-bahif: Zorokox Partners plans to lower the Casax list price by 28.0 percent in April. The board signed off on a budget of $271.0 million for Project Juldor. The renewal with Pelokox Partners closes at $410.1 million a year, 3.4 percent below the last contract. Project Pelok slips by a full year because of the audit delay.

**Environment Variables — Quillhopper Queue Migration**

Welcome aboard! We're replacing the old homegrown job queue ("Trundle") with Quillhopper. Most vars carry over, but Quillhopper needs its own broker credentials and won't start without them — it just loops printing "awaiting handshake," which confuses everyone. To get your local worker talking to the dev broker, add this line to your env file.

sealed setting: VAULT_KEY20=69e2a0b23f1a79fbf692

**Ticket VLT-providing: Locked vault blocking report export fix**

The Quillward reports vault auto-locked after three failed opens, so nobody can ship the timezone patch. Background: exports currently stamp rows in server-local time, and customers in other regions see shifted dates. The fix (store UTC, convert at render) is ready but the config lives in the vault. New folks: don't retry the open manually. Unlock it with the passphrase below.

vault phrase of kawep-tahog = ulaix-briath